Lot 1199

A 1936 WURLITZER CINEMA PIPE ORGAN serial number OPUS 2200 originally shipped to the UK on 16th October 1936 and installed in the Granada Cinema, East Ham, London, the organ consisted originally of 8 ranks of pipes, these being Tibia Clausa, Diaphonic, Diapason, Clarinet, Trumpet, Vox Humana, Flute, Violin and Violin Celeste, In addition it has a Tuned Xylophone, Glockenspiel and Vibraphone as well as various other percussion effects such as Bass drum, snare drum and cymbals along with sound effects for film such as bird whistle, train whistle, fire gong etc. Since its install some changes have been made to this instrument including new keyboard replaced after bomb damage in 1944, in the 1960s the violin and celeste ranks were replaced by Gambas, although the present owner has returned these back to original, the Clarinet rank has been changed for a Kinura and the piano section changed for an electronic version. The console was resprayed by David Thorpe of Ashbourne to an amazing standard. This organ was removed from the its East Ham home in 1975 and reinstalled is a novelty item at a railway station on a miniature railway in Kessington, Suffolk before passing through the hand of two further owners who despite spending much time and monies refurbishing parts of the organ but never succeeding in getting it playing again. The present owner, after much persuading by The Birmingham Odeons master cinema organist Steve Tovey, saved the instrument from slowly deteriorating in a container in November 2000. It was transported and craned into its new home, a purpose built mini theatre at his home. During 2001 it was lovingly restored and rebuilt with Steve Tovey' guidance and the assistance of The Cinema Organ Societies Cameron Lloyd. This mini theatre opened in November 2001 (almost 65 years after its original appearance) and since has been played by most of the UKs top organists and enjoyed by audiences up until 5 years ago. This organ is still in working order and still in situ at this Cannock based mini Theatre which is attached to the present owners home.
